Catholic parishes ‘can help’ refugees

An appeal to Catholic parishes to take in refugees could see several thousand families from Syria and other conflict countries rehomed across the country.

The appeal, sparked by simultaneous calls from Pope Francis and the Bishop of Elphin, is to be discussed by the Irish Bishops Conference at the end of this month.

Pope Francis on Sunday called on all Catholic parishes and religious communities in Europe to take in one refugee family each and said the Vatican would lead by example by itself offering accommodation.
